Azure AD SSO,未找到 login.live
Posted
技术标签:
【中文标题】Azure AD SSO,未找到 login.live【英文标题】:Azure AD SSO, login.live not found 【发布时间】:2022-01-14 05:33:40 【问题描述】:我使用带有 cognito 的 aws 无服务器架构。我需要实现天蓝色的活动目录。我已设法设置所有配置以使用 OpenId 将我的 azure AD 帐户与 aws cognito 连接起来。 因此,当我尝试使用 Azure AD 登录时,它会显示只有电子邮件地址字段的登录页面。当我添加电子邮件地址并单击下一步时,它显示此错误 login.live 未找到。 我可以绕过这个,只有先登录到我的 azure Active Directory 帐户,然后转到我的应用并单击 SSO azure AD,它不会显示我的登录页面,而是自动登录用户。
那么任何人都可以帮助我解决这个问题,用户应该使用 AD 登录,而无需先使用 azure 帐户登录。
【问题讨论】:
【参考方案1】:您需要创建或编辑您的登录/注册流程:https://docs.microsoft.com/en-us/azure/active-directory-b2c/identity-provider-microsoft-account?pivots=b2c-custom-policy
如果您没有添加外部身份提供商,它将无法识别电子邮件。或者您需要先使用用户流程进行注册。
【讨论】:
以上是关于Azure AD SSO,未找到 login.live的主要内容,如果未能解决你的问题,请参考以下文章
Azure AD 与 AWS IAM 集成实现SSO—上(Azure部分)
使用 Azure Active Directory 或 ADFS 或 AD 的 SSO
Java Spring 应用程序 - 与 Azure AD 集成以实现 SSO